Consider a radioactive substance with original weight 20grams given by W(x)= 20 x (0.95)^x, where W(x) is with weight after x years. In about how many years is the radioactive substance half of its original weight? Type answer to one decimal place.
Answer:
13.5 years
Step-by-step explanation:
We are given the expression:
W(x)= 20 x (0.95)^x
Where W(x) = 20grams/2
= 10 grams
Hence:
10 = 20 x (0.95)^x
Divide both sides by 20
10/20 = 20 x (0.95)^x/20
0.5 = (0.95)^x
Take the log of both sides
log 0.5 = log (0.95)^x
log 0.5 = x log (0.95)
Divide both sides by log 0.95
x = log 0.5 / log 0.95
x = 13.513407334 years
Approximately to 1 decimal place =✓13.5 years
Therefore, it will take 13.5 years for the radioactive substance to be half of its original weight.

After 4 years eldi will be three times the age he had 10 years ago. Using algebra find the age of eldi
Suppose that Eldi has x years old now :
x + 4 = 3 × ( x - 10 )
x + 4 = 3x - 30
Add both sides 30
x + 4 + 30 = 3x - 30 + 30
x + 34 = 3x
Subtract both sides x
x - x + 34 = 3x - x
34 = 2x
2x = 34
Divide both sides by 2
2x ÷ 2 =34 ÷ 2
x = 17
_____________________________
Thus Eldi is 17 .
